学Excel,肯定要学函数,函数学得好,在Excel应用中就会如鱼得水。
今天我们一起来学习一下,Excel中的函数之有:replace函数。
Replace函数,顾名思义,就是“替换”,即功能就是执行替换操作,替换字符中的指定字符。
一、Replace函数语法
语法格式:
REPLACE(old_text, start_num, num_chars,new_text),
通俗一点表达就是:
ReplaceB(源文本,替换开始位置,替换字节数,新的文本)。
函数参数:
参数 描述
old_text 源文本,也就是将要执行替换操作的文本。
start_num 开始替换的位置。
num_chars 要替换的长度,既要替换的字节数。
new_text 新文本,也就是替换成的文本。
注意:第四个参数是文本,要加上引号。
二、举个简单例子说明
1、以下图,在B2中,输入: =REPLACE(A1,4,2,"HT"),
我们可以看到,此时A2返回结果是:YX-HT-2018012001。
公式:=REPLACE(A1,4,2,"HT")的意思是:A1单元格的字符,从第4个字符(也就是“J”)起,将连续的2个字符(也就是“JS”),替换成“HT”。
2、以下图,在B2中,输入: =REPLACE(A1,6,1,""),
此时,A2返回的结果是:YX-JS-2018012001。
公式:=REPLACE(A1,6,1,"")的意思是:A1单元格的字符,从第6个字符(也就是字符串里的第二个“-”)起,将1个字符(也就是“-”),替换成空。
三、replace函数的实际应用
例如:以下为一份客户的信息表。
当要把这份表发给别人看时,为了隐私安全,要把电话号码中间四位,即第四位至第七位加密隐藏,就可以用replace函数来实现。
操作方法如下:
插入新的一列E列,在E3单元格,输入公式:=REPLACE(D3,4,4,"****"),然后公式向下填充即可,如下图:
公式:=REPLACE(D3,4,4,"****")的意思:D3单元格的字符,从第4个字符开始,将连续的4个字符替换成“****”。
Copyright (C) 1999-20120 www.ahcar.com, All Rights Reserved
版权所有 环球快报网 | 联系我们:265 073 543 9@qq.com